8.2.2 FlexPower with Integrated Battery
A few FlexPower devices operate using a 3.6V lithium D cell battery integrated into the housing.
These integrated battery devices:
Operate only from the battery and cannot use an external power supply,
Are limited in the available I/O because of the limited connectivity, and
Can only be powered from the integrated battery.
8.2.3 FlexPower
®
Solar Supply
Banner’s FlexPower Solar Supply Assembly can be used to power up to two radio devices, including a FlexPower Node, a
FlexPower Gateway, or a data radio.
When used with a FlexPower Node and sensors, the Solar Assembly
supplies enough power to run most sensors at higher sample and
report rates than a single battery can reasonably support.
Rechargeable batteries power the devices while the solar panel
recharges the batteries.
